Sickle Mower: An Old Time Haymaker

from: Maxx Home Guides



Generally, a sickle mower is a handy machine or device originally made for cutting cereal, but was later adapted for cutting grasses or plants off the ground -- in what might be considered a ‘revolution' that was achieved and extremely popular in the 1960s.

One very useful job it was mostly used for was that of cutting grasses, which were later treated as nutritional food, called "hay" for farm animals, such as sheep, goats, rabbits, cattle, and pigs among others. Haymaking was mostly done throughout the winter months when grass would die anyway.

Although, there are other mowers like reel mowers, rowse mowers, rotary disk mowers, professional mowers, and others; the sickle mower (also called reciprocating sickle) -- partly due to its simplicity -- was widely preferred in the eastern hemisphere like India, where it could only be used for much smaller jobs.

The sickle mower is affixed with a piece of sickle bar (where it probably derives its name), and has 5 - 7' cutting bar blades meant to grasses. Though quite small, arduous and ineffective for large or commercial haymaking, it nevertheless had a few positive points for haymakers in those early days.

It was quite effective in cutting and dropping down hay still in original shape and condition -- it does not break or sprinkle hay. Also, when improved with the pittman arm, which pulled it back and forth while sliding in a fixed position, it could cut crops much easier on smooth surfaces.

However, while for bigger jobs, such as haymaking, it was economical, the sickle mower was no longer desirable. So with time, it was further improved upon, and that little ‘revolution' was known as sickle haybine. This one generally combines the BAR technology of the ‘old' sickle mower, but was strengthened with a frontal reel, that has ability to haul up strong and even bent stalks at a much faster and efficient work rate.

Also, it has an internal device, specifically designed to break stems of thick grasses, thereby condition the hay ready for faster drying. This was a benefit the earlier sickle mower couldn't do.

Notwithstanding, the sickle is not dead, but readily alive. It's still being used, but mostly by homemakers and small farm owners. And they are widely regarded as pieces of antiquity, thereby becoming a great delight of antique collectors and people looking for old and cheap materials.
